Narrative Through Album Covers
Album covers function as more than just artistic elements. They often depict a story about the album. By using photography, designers create a visual representation that complements and expands the listening adventure. A well-designed album cover can engage listeners, igniting their interest and setting the tone for the music within.
Some album covers are instantly iconic, like Pink Floyd's "Dark Side of the Moon" with its circular prism design, or Nirvana's "Nevermind" featuring a controversial image of a baby. These covers have become icons of their respective albums and movements, showcasing the significant impact that visual storytelling can make on music culture.
